10/1 8a |
20.4M |
Lighthouse Hill
Ranch 20M Trail Race |
3:32:36 (1:44:56|1:47:40) |
Near Johnson City, Texas |
SAL10 |
7/5 |
First Race of the New Season. Run okay on a rolling, frequently rocky
trail on the Lighthouse Hill Ranch that goes around a lighthouse
on a hill with no ships within 200 miles, also being the hightest point in
Blanco County. Talked to a lot of interesting people at the Postrace Party
which had catered Barbecue. I forgot my GU in the car and was forced to
eat penut and jelly sandwiches at miles 5, 13 and 15 which worked out
fine---I also had tortillas, traces of eggs, patatoes, and mexican
breakfast beans at 6a. Ran well endurance-wise slowing down slightly less
that 3 minutes on the second loop, which was good because it warmed up
quite quickly and that there was very little shade on the course; (12/19o;
2/2a---an unusual way to win an age group; probably was the oldest male
participant in the race). T=53-75; H=72-21%. |

1/15, 7a |
26.2 |
Houston Marathon |
did not start! |
Houston, Texas |
|
|
Decided Saturday afternoon not to run the Marathon as my heel is still too sensitive and unlikely will last for more than 15-20 miles; will take now a 2-6 months break from running---unfortunately, this is how long it takes to get rid of achilles tendinitis. When I watched the race with all the hipe and the ideal conditions, I felt kind of jealous of the other runners and was not sure if I made the right decision, but if I would have run it, I am sure I would have limped for a week and might have run into other problems because of the cold and last week's tiredness. Anyhow, time to focus on other things soon... Hopefully in the second half of 2012 I will be running strong again! |
